深入探讨区块链平台运行机制及其应用前景
区块链平台的定义及工作原理
区块链是一种分布式账本技术,它通过网络中多台计算机(节点)共同维护一份数据记录,实现数据的去中心化存储。每个节点都保存着这份账本的副本,任何试图修改这些数据的行为都需要得到网络中其他节点的共识。
在区块链的结构中,数据被组织成区块,每个区块中包含了一定量的交易信息,并且通过密码学技术与前一个区块相连,形成链条。因此,区块链的名字由此得来。这种设计确保修改历史数据的设置几乎是不可能的,因为必须同时更改整个网络中所有节点的记录。
区块链平台的运行依靠两个基本要素:共识机制和智能合约。共识机制确保网络各节点对数据的一致性达成共识,如比特币的工作量证明(PoW)和以太坊的股份证明(PoS)。智能合约则是一种自动执行的合约,能够在预设的条件触发时自动执行预定操作,为区块链应用的创新提供了无限可能。
区块链平台的分类及典型应用

区块链平台大致可以分为公有链、私有链和联盟链三种。公有链对任何用户都开放,大家都可以参与网络的维护和数据添加。而私有链则是有限的可参与者控制的网络,适合企业内部应用。联盟链是公有链和私有链的结合,通常由多个组织共同维护,用于特定行业的应用。
随着区块链技术的发展,其应用逐渐拓展至多个领域。金融领域,区块链技术通过提供去中心化的支付和清算方式,降低了交易成本,提高了效率。供应链管理中,区块链可以有效追踪物品的流转,提高透明度。而在身份验证、市政管理、知识产权保护等领域,区块链也展现出了良好的应用前景。
区块链平台的优势和挑战
区块链平台具有多重优势,包括去中心化、透明性、不可篡改性和高安全性,这些特点使其在多个行业中,不断受到应用的重视。但是,区块链技术并非没有挑战,例如能耗问题、网络延迟、扩展性和法律合规性等问题亟待解决。
以比特币为例,其PoW共识机制的高能耗就引发了广泛讨论。而在某些商业应用中,交易速度和处理效率也是制约其发展的关键因素。此外,法律法规的滞后也时常让区块链技术的应用面临困境,个别地区甚至会因为合规问题限制区块链项目的开展。
区块链技术的未来发展趋势

尽管面临挑战,区块链仍然被认为是未来科技的重要组成部分。通过技术不断迭代与,区块链将逐渐克服现有瓶颈。在性能提升方面,Sharding、Off-chain等解决方案将被日益采用。在隐私保护方面,零知识证明等先进技术也将成为推动行业进步的关键。
未来的区块链不仅会在金融领域有所突破,医疗、教育、能源等新兴领域的整合也将不断推动区块链的发展。同时,跨链技术的发展将有助于不同区块链之间的数据和资产整合,从而实现更广泛的应用场景。
如何选择合适的区块链平台
选择合适的区块链平台是企业实施区块链技术的首要步骤。首先,企业需分析自身的业务需求,明确应用场景。公有链适合对透明度要求高的场景,如捐赠和投票系统,而私有链适用于需要高隐私保护的场景,如医疗记录存储。
其次,技术团队的技术能力也是一个不容忽视的因素。不同的平台有着不同的开发语言和工具,团队需要具备相应的技术储备,才能高效地进行开发。此外,考虑社区活跃度、开发文档和商业支持也极为关键。
区块链的监管和合规问题
随着区块链技术的持续普及,监管和合规的问题变得尤为突出。各国对区块链及加密货币的监管政策差异巨大,因此企业在开展相关业务前,须充分研究当地的法律法规并遵循相应的规定。
此外,行业标准的制定也将推动整个区块链市场的健康发展。一些国际组织和行业协会正在积极制定相应的标准,以便为区块链平台的开发与运营提供指导,确保其在合规范围内合法运行。
区块链技术的社会影响
区块链技术的普及可能会引发一系列社会变化。例如,去中心化的特性将改变传统金融体系,使小型企业能够更轻松地获得便利的贷款。此外,智能合约可以提升效率,降低合约履行过程中的非必要成本。
不论是身份验证还是数据维护,区块链都能为用户带来更高的控制权与透明度。特别是在公共服务领域,区块链有可能让政务服务透明化、便民化,从而进一步提升公众对政府的信任度。
如何学习和应用区块链技术
对于希望进入区块链领域的人士,学习与应用这一先进技术是一项长期而持续的过程。首先,可以通过阅读相关书籍、研究论文以及在线课程来建立基础知识。其次,实际操作也极为关键,可以通过参与开源项目,提升编程技能,进而深入理解区块链的开发过程。
此外,行业会议和交流会也是获取最新动态与技术趋势的宝贵途径。在这些活动中,与其他专业人士、开发者进行交流与讨论,可以获得经验分享与洞察,更好地把握区块链技术的未来趋势。
综上所述,区块链平台的运行不仅仅是技术的堆砌,更是一场全新的技术革命。通过对其机制的理解以及对应用前景的探索,我们能够更好地把握住这个时代的机遇,推动相关行业的转型与升级。